Brief history of dating sim games
Dating sim games, also known as “bishoujo” or “gal games,” started in Japan in the 1980s. These were video games about creating a romantic relationship between the player’s character and one or more virtual characters. An example of these early games is 1994’s Angelique, released by KOEI. They could be played on consoles like Sega Saturn and PlayStation.
The 2000s saw dating sims become even more popular. Loads of titles were released for PC, PlayStation Portable and Nintendo DS. One of the most influential was Tokimeki Memorial, with different storylines and character stats that could be improved with activities.
In recent years, dating sims have become even more popular because they can now be played on smartphones and tablets. There are many dating sim apps in the app store, so players can play at any time and any place.

Differences between stat-driven and raising sim games
Dating sim games come in two types: stat-driven and raising sim games. To understand them better, we made a table:
Game Type | Focus | Customization | Progression |
---|---|---|---|
Stat-driven | Stats | Limited | Linear progression based on meeting stat requirements |
Raising sim games | Dialogue and interactions | Extensive | Non-linear progression based on building relationships with characters |
Stats are the main focus in stat-driven games, but customization is limited. In raising sim games, dialogue and interactions affect relationship levels and customization is usually extensive. Stat-driven games usually have linear progression based on meeting stat requirements, while raising sim games have non-linear progression based on building relationships with characters.
Both types of games have advantages and disadvantages, depending on the player’s goals. Stat-driven games have clearer objectives and limited customization options. Raising sim games allow more flexibility in character development, but may lack clear goals or direction.

Overview of Otome Games
Otome Games are a dating simulation genre designed for female audiences. Players take on the role of a single female protagonist and make choices to progress through the game. They can choose romantic partners from a range of categories, such as otaku, idols, celebs, and even supernatural beings.
The game’s storytelling takes players through a variety of backgrounds, like schools, workplaces, and virtual worlds. Women feel empowered by taking control of their romantic lives through this game.
Otome Games are praised for their strong-willed female characters, who independently make decisions about romance. They offer both sentiment and excitement, making it perfect for female video game players.

Virtual stores
Virtual stores provide an incentive for players to keep coming back. Here, they can buy in-game currency, clothing, accessories, and special features. This encourages repeat play and longer engagement.
Monetization must be balanced – it shouldn’t be too overbearing or frustrating. Offer fun rewards at an affordable price.
Limited-time offers during events like holidays or milestones can create excitement. This adds scarcity and another layer of engagement.

NPC likes
In dating sims, NPCs are important for the gameplay. You must understand their likes and dislikes. They might prefer certain looks, personalities, or hobbies. Meeting these can unlock new storylines and dialogue. In some games, NPCs may even have different levels of affection. But, remember, they have dislikes, too!
To keep things interesting, NPC likes may change throughout the game. Paying attention to them is essential. But, it’s not just about fulfilling preferences. Other factors like dialogue and compatibility count, too.

Examples of successful dating sim apps
Want to create a successful dating sim app? There are a few important features to keep in mind. For example, My Candy Love, Mystic Messenger, and Love Nikki-Dress UP Queen have become popular due to their unique elements.
My Candy Love has a strong storyline that fascinates players. Mystic Messenger allows users to interact with characters in real-time. Love Nikki-Dress UP Queen allows for character customization and personalization.
Every dating sim app doesn’t need these specific features to be successful. It’s all about understanding the target audience and creating features they want and need.
All successful dating sim apps have something in common: warmth and connection through design and dialogue. This draws in and keeps players in the game.
